Description  
202302-001  
The OLH6000/6001 has an LED and integrated high-speed  
detector that are mounted and coupled in a hermetic 8-pin side  
brazed Dual Inline Package (DIP), which provides 1500 VDC  
electrical isolation between the input and output. The light from  
the LED is collected by the photo-diode in the integrated detector.  
The integrated detector incorporates a Schmitt trigger, which  
provides hysteresis for noise immunity and pulse shaping and an  
open collector output. Typical propagation delay of this product is  
170 ns. The CMR transient immunity is greater than 1000 V/ꢀs at  
300 VCM.

Exposure to maximum rating conditions for extended periods may reduce device reliability. There is no damage to the device with only one parameter set at the limit and all other parameters  
set at or below their nominal value. Exceeding any of the limits listed here may result in permanent damage to the device.  
Measured between pins 1, 2, 3, and 4 shorted together, and pins 5, 6, 7, and 8 shorted together. TA =25 °C and duration = 1 s.  
CAUTION: Although this device is designed to be as robust as possible, electrostatic discharge (ESD) can damage this device. This device  
must be protected at all times from ESD. Static charges may easily produce potentials of several kilovolts on the human body  
or equipment, which can discharge without detection. Industry-standard ESD precautions should be used at all times.
